Housing Prices in Central Ca

Homes are really dropping here in central CA. Down the street there is a sign that says "New homes starting at $239,000." This is in a gated community. In the next town there is a sign that says "New homes starting at $199,000."

Last year the home for $239,000. was going for $350,000. I work on a real estate magazine. Some of the homes have dropped as much as a $100,000. in the last six months. Many of the realtors are now advertising that they are "Foreclosure Experts". Homes are being marketed as "Short Sale" or "Bank Owned".

We have been hit hard here in CA. Our home would need to go up $100,000. for us to break even on what we owe on it. Does anyone see an end to the down slide of the home market?
